Il 10/01/24 15:14, Julien Stephan ha scritto:
> From: Phi-bang Nguyen <pnguyen at baylibre.com>
> 
> This driver provides a path to bypass the SoC ISP so that image data
> coming from the SENINF can go directly into memory without any image
> processing. This allows the use of an external ISP.
